ITEM 1.01 ENTRY INTO A MATERIAL DEFINITIVE AGREEMENT

On May 21, 2010, Zion Oil & Gas Inc. (the “Company”) and Aladdin Middle East Ltd. (“AME”), a Delaware corporation with offices in Wichita, Kansas and in Ankara, Turkey, amended the drilling contract that they originally executed on September 12, 2008 and subsequently amended (the “Agreement”).

Under the recently executed amendment, AME and the Company extended the term of the Agreement to cover the drilling of the Company’s planned Ma’anit-Joseph #3 well to a depth of 5,900 meters.  In addition, Article 608 of the Agreement was amended in order to transfer to AME the burden of certain taxes that may be owed.  Under the Amendment, AME is to reimburse the Company for certain insurance premiums incurred by the Company.  The Amendment also memorialized an advance, previously remitted by the Company to AME, in an amount of $750,000 and provided that the amount of the advance will be recovered by offset against future AME invoices.

The foregoing description of the transaction is only a summary and is qualified in its entirety by reference to the Amendment No. 4 to the International Daywork Drilling Contract-Land attached hereto as Exhibit 10.1, which is incorporated herein by reference.
